ABOUT S.O.S.
Mission: Raising voices for justice, healing and joy.
Description: Singers of the Street is a San Francisco-based choir for people who are homeless or disadvantaged and those who support them. S.O.S. rehearses weekly and singers are provided with a free meal at each rehearsal or appearance. No auditions or experience are required - just a love of singing. Singers benefit through improved self-esteem, socialization, community building and community service.
